Choose the Right Platform
The first step in creating a website or eCommerce shop is to choose the right platform. There are many platforms available, such as WordPress, Shopify, Magento, and Squarespace. Each platform has its own set of features, strengths, and weaknesses. Consider your business needs, budget, and technical expertise before choosing a platform.
Define Your Brand Identity
Your website or eCommerce shop should reflect your brand identity. Define your brand’s color scheme, typography, and design elements before creating your website. Your brand identity should be consistent across all your online and offline platforms.
Design Your Website or eCommerce Shop
Design your website or eCommerce shop with a focus on user experience. A good design is aesthetically pleasing, easy to navigate, and fast-loading. Use a minimalist approach, and avoid cluttering your website with too many design elements. Use high-quality images and videos to enhance the user experience.
Optimize Your Website for Mobile Devices
Most internet users access the internet from mobile devices, such as smartphones and tablets. Therefore, it’s essential to optimize your website or eCommerce shop for mobile devices. Use responsive design to ensure your website adjusts to the screen size of the device used to access it.
Create High-Quality Content
High-quality content is essential for engaging visitors and improving your website’s SEO. Use compelling headlines, informative articles, and visual elements to make your content more engaging. Avoid using jargon or technical terms that may be difficult for visitors to understand.
Use SEO Best Practices
Search engine optimization (SEO) is the process of optimizing your website for search engines. Use best practices, such as using relevant keywords, creating meta descriptions, and optimizing images, to improve your website’s ranking on search engine results pages (SERPs).
Provide a Secure and Easy Checkout Process
If you have an eCommerce shop, ensure your checkout process is secure and easy to use. Use a reputable payment gateway, such as PayPal or Stripe, to process payments. Ensure your website uses SSL encryption to protect sensitive data.
